Description:
Job Summary:

Plans, develops, and implements provisions of quality nursing care for efficient operation of 24-hour, 7-days-a-week unit. Serves as manager, practitioner, educator, mentor, and consultant. Guides nursing leadership toward excellence in practice and serves a role model. Supervises assigned staff.

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Responds to patient/family complaints. Fulfills role of advocate for patients and families. Monitors and coordinates patient care provided by nursing on 24-hour basis. Provides nursing consultation to unit staff, peers, other hospital personnel, adjunct staff and nursing students and instructors.
  • Responds to unit emergencies. Directs staff in crisis situations. Fulfills role of nursing staff advocate. Listens to staff concerns. Responds in clear, calm, consistent and timely manner. Ensures staff development. Coordinates unit in-services to meet identified core and unit focused competencies.
  • Schedules and assigns staff in accordance with patient care, budget guidelines, and current unit acuities. Promotes effective use of resources. Attends and participates in nursing department and other assigned meetings. Develops and implements plans/projects to improve operational efficiency and effectiveness. Monitors and reports status and progress to supervisor.
  • Monitors and evaluates quality and appropriateness of patient care, quality control items and patient satisfaction. Maintains safe environment. Tracks status of identified problems or areas of non-compliance to ensure effectiveness of corrective action.
  • Serves as resource technical expert/spokesperson in area of specialization assuring provision of safe patient care. May perform patient care to the extent necessary to maintain clinical expertise, competency, and licensing necessary to fulfill job responsibilities and to direct the provision of care on the unit.
  • Provides direct patient care on an as needed basis. Provides services that are within scope of license and in compliance with all legal, regulatory and policy requirements relevant to clinical role performed.
  • Incorporates the KP Nursing Vision, Model and Values throughout their Nursing practice.
  • Hires, trains, supervises, counsels, disciplines, and terminates assigned staff as appropriate.
  • Communicates goals, objectives and accountabilities, priorities, and authority parameters to assigned staff.
Basic Qualifications:

Experience


  • Minimum three (3) years of clinical nursing experience relevant to a given positions/department required.

  • One (1) year supervisory or completion of nurse manager fellowship within one year of hire.


Education


  • Bachelors degree in Nursing by date of hire.


License, Certification, Registration


  • Registered Nurse License (Hawaii)



  • Basic Life Support from American Heart Association



  • Advanced Cardiac Life Support within 12 months of hire from American Heart Association



Additional Requirements:


  • National Certification in Specialty within one (1) year of hire and maintained thereafter; or for new (inexperienced) nurse manager the timeframe needed to meet the eligibility requirement.

  • Demonstrated knowledge of and skill in adaptability, change management, decision making, detail oriented, customer service, influence, interpersonal relations, oral communication, prioritization, problem solving, quality management, results orientation, system thinking, teamwork, time management, written communication competencies.

  • Knowledge of Nurse Practice Act, TJC and other local, state and federal regulations.

  • Must be able to work in a Labor/Management Partnership environment.



Preferred Qualifications:


  • Demonstrated knowledge of and skill in word processing, spreadsheet, and database PC applications.

  • Masters degree in nursing administration or public health administration.
